Man held with ganja to be sentenced next Friday
MONTEGO BAY- Steve Cooper, a St Ann man who now resides in New York in the United States, pleaded guilty in the Montego Bay Resident Magistrates Court to trying to export nearly 45lbs of ganja in October last year.
Cooper was arrested at the Sangster International Airport on October 4 after police sniffer dogs alerted their handlers to contraband in his luggage. When the two bags he had checked in were searched, compressed ganja weighing 44lbs 13.7 ounces was found concealed among coffee and chocolate.
Cooper was scheduled to leave the island on Air Jamaica flight 011 to New York.
He was remanded in police custody and will be sentenced next Friday.
